Latest Patents

Among his latest patents, Lee has developed a **Method of forming a trench for use in manufacturing a semiconductor device**. This method involves creating a photoresist pattern on a substrate, where an initial trench is formed using the photoresist pattern as a mask. Following this, a second etching process enlarges the initial trench, allowing for a stable structure that can accommodate metal wiring, isolation films, or contacts to desired dimensions.

Another noteworthy patent is the **Method of chemical mechanical polishing**, which polishes a substrate by abrading a target material using a polishing pad with slurry. This innovative process includes setting a polishing end time, thus allowing for a predetermined thickness of the target material to be removed. During polishing, the level of byproduct contamination increased, decreasing the polishing rate to zero at the end time, ensuring precision and accuracy in the manufacturing process.
